Output 169cafab4be1772423efa34763471d0856f05aef67508b4aaf1a9db469f2ea8c:12

value
593287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e60f53eb8b4a5586a3f4f4859951a2551109c2b3 OP_EQUAL
address
3NfThfE24oNzFT3hLue6Ye3rxVqUAUkYUw
transaction
169cafab4be1772423efa34763471d0856f05aef67508b4aaf1a9db469f2ea8c
spent
true